Преглед изворни кода

更新版本1.0.20,自主上传app

panxingxin пре 5 година
родитељ
комит
7697c436dd
4 измењених фајлова са 9 додато и 9 уклоњено
  1. BIN
      app-debug.apk
  2. 1 2
      config.xml
  3. 3 2
      prod.sh
  4. 5 5
      src/providers/user-data.ts

+ 1 - 2
config.xml

@@ -1,5 +1,5 @@
 <?xml version='1.0' encoding='utf-8'?>
-<widget id="com.ionicframework.sgZongLi" version="1.0.8" xmlns="http://www.w3.org/ns/widgets" xmlns:cdv="http://cordova.apache.org/ns/1.0">
+<widget id="com.ionicframework.sgZongLi" version="1.0.20" xmlns="http://www.w3.org/ns/widgets" xmlns:cdv="http://cordova.apache.org/ns/1.0">
     <name>SG综礼</name>
     <description>An awesome Ionic/Cordova app.</description>
     <author email="hi@ionicframework.com" href="http://ionicframework.com/">Ionic Framework Team</author>
@@ -99,5 +99,4 @@
     <plugin name="cordova-plugin-device" spec="2.0.2" />
     <plugin name="cordova-plugin-splashscreen" spec="5.0.2" />
     <plugin name="cordova-plugin-ionic-webview" spec="^4.0.0" />
-    <plugin name="cordova-plugin-ionic-keyboard" spec="^2.0.5" />
 </widget>

+ 3 - 2
prod.sh

@@ -13,9 +13,10 @@ echo '{
 
 #sed -e "s@1@$cversion_old@g" -i version.json
 
-ionic cordova build android --prod
+# ionic cordova build android --prod
 
-mv  ./platforms/android/app/build/outputs/apk/debug/app-debug.apk  ./sgApp.apk
+# mv  ./platforms/android/app/build/outputs/apk/debug/app-debug.apk  ./sgApp.apk
+mv  ./app-debug.apk  ./sgApp.apk
 
 scp -r ./sgApp.apk root@192.168.20.16:/usr/app
 

+ 5 - 5
src/providers/user-data.ts

@@ -187,7 +187,7 @@ export class UserData {
       from(this.nativeHttp.post(`${environment.APP_SERVE_URL}/production/sample/factory/pCode`,
         data,
         headers)).pipe(
-          finalize(() => { })
+          finalize(() => loading.dismiss() )
         ).subscribe(async data => {
           if (JSON.parse(data.data).code == 1) {
             const toast = await this.toastCtrl.create({
@@ -223,7 +223,7 @@ export class UserData {
       from(this.nativeHttp.post(`${environment.APP_SERVE_URL}/production/sample/factory/details/`,
         data,
         headers)).pipe(
-          finalize(() => { })
+          finalize(() => loading.dismiss())
         ).subscribe(async data => {
           let message = ''
           if (JSON.parse(data.data).code == 1) {
@@ -356,14 +356,14 @@ export class UserData {
   // 获取样品单QA详情
   async getSampleQAlog(sdpId: Number): Promise<any> {
     const token = await this.getToken();
-    // let loading = await this.loadingCtrl.create();
-    // await loading.present();
+    let loading = await this.loadingCtrl.create();
+    await loading.present();
     this.nativeHttp.setDataSerializer('json');
     const headers = { Authorization: `Bearer ${token}`, 'Content-Type': 'application/json;charset=UTF-8' };
     return new Promise((resolve, reject) => {
       from(this.nativeHttp.get(`${environment.APP_SERVE_URL}/production/samples/mobile/qalog/${sdpId}`, {},
         headers)).pipe(
-          finalize(() => { })
+          finalize(() => loading.dismiss())
         ).subscribe(async data => {
           resolve(data.data);
         }, async err => {